What is Google MUM?
The Google MUM is meant to answer search queries using an AI-powered search algorithm to boost online search proficiency.
It aims to remove any unnecessary effort to perform multiple searches. It has the capability to not only understand and deliver solutions on just textual content, but also through the interpretation of images, videos, podcasts and much more.
It can understand 75 languages, inferring that it can deliver great results and provide a comprehensive search experience, answering even the most complicated searches.

MUM vs BERT
BERT (Bidirectional Encoder Representations from Transformers) came in 2019 and comprehended user searches much better than its predecessors.
At this time, keywords became key phrases looking to offer results based on user intent. In other words, it was mostly text content that need to answer those queries.

Ways by which Google’s MUM can Improve your Search results
MUM is an element that Google can put to use to develop an array of new experiences. Here are a few ways by which MUM can overall improve your search experience.
- Words and images: MUM is capable of understanding images, video, and audio and not just information in text form.
With MUM, you can snap a picture, then add on text to perform a search that might be difficult to express with pictures or words alone.
This new aspect will also be seen in a new terrific feature Google is building for its Google Lens search tool, which will allow you to perform a search by just pointing your smartphone’s camera towards an object in the real world.
- Videos interpreted: It has been challenging for Google to comprehend a video just with the accuracy with which it can describe text-based content.
Not anymore.
With MUM, Google can detect whether several videos are related to a concept even if they’re not associated by the use of the exact same term. This allows it to group videos based on whether they reflect a concept even if they do not use a relevant phrase.
